Overview

The PAUPME – Customs Tariffs offers a loan of up to 150 000 $ to SMEs directly or indirectly affected by US tariffs, with revenue between 200 000 $ and 2 M$. It supports working capital to maintain operations and facilitate adaptation to the new business reality, notably through productivity gains or market diversification.
